Description
Summary:A measurement of the inclusive ZZ production cross section and constraints on anomalous triple gauge couplings in proton–proton collisions at √s = 8 TeV are presented. The analysis is based on a data sample, corresponding to an integrated luminosity of 19.6 fb[superscript −1], collected with the CMS experiment at the LHC. The measurements are performed in the leptonic decay modes ZZ→ℓℓℓ′ℓ′, where ℓ=e,μ and ℓ′=e,μ,τ. The measured total cross section σ(pp→ZZ)=7.7±0.5 (stat)[+0.5 over −0.4](syst)±0.4(theo)±0.2 (lumi) pb, for both Z bosons produced in the mass range 60<[subscript mZ] <120 GeV60<mZ<120 GeV, is consistent with standard model predictions. Differential cross sections are measured and well described by the theoretical predictions. The invariant mass distribution of the four-lepton system is used to set limits on anomalous ZZZ and ZZγ couplings at the 95% confidence level: −0.004 < f[Z over 4] <0.004, −0.004 < f[Z over 5] < 0.004, −0.005 < f[γ over 4] < 0.005, and −0.005 < f[γ over 5] < 0.005.
